3 arrested as Gardaí raid suspected Ennis Brothel

A suspected brothel in County Clare has been uncovered by Gardaí as part of a nationwide crackdown on organised prostitution.

Officers raid the premises in Ennis yesterday and three people, two men and a woman were subsequently arrested.

Overall 120 houses, apartments and flats were searched on both sides of the border in the joint operation by Gardaí and the PSNI.

Superintendent Peter Duff of Ennis Garda Station says the raid here in the county was the result of intelligence gathered prior to yesterday’s search.

Three people, two men and a woman were arrested following the raid in Ennis and questioned at Ennis Garda Station.

They have since been released without charge and a file is being prepared for the Director of Public Prosecutions.

The Mayor of Ennis Michael Guilfoyle has welcomed the garda operation in Ennis and praised the efforts of local Gardaí in tackling organised prostitution.

He also urged landlords across the county to be  vigilant of any unusual activity in residential properties that they may be leasing out.
